suselinux关防火墙命令
-
使用Selinux关防火墙的命令非常简单。下面是一些常用的Selinux关防火墙的命令:
1. 查看Selinux是否已启用:
`$ sestatus`2. 暂时禁用Selinux:
“`
$ setenforce 0
$ sestatus # 验证Selinux状态
“`3. 永久禁用Selinux:
将`SELINUX=enforcing`改为`SELINUX=disabled`。
编辑`/etc/selinux/config`文件:“`
$ vi /etc/selinux/config
“`
将`SELINUX=enforcing`改为`SELINUX=disabled`。4. 重新启用Selinux:
“`
$ setenforce 1
$ sestatus # 验证Selinux状态
“`通过这些命令,您可以轻松地启用或禁用Selinux防火墙。请根据需要选择合适的命令来管理Selinux防火墙。
2年前 -
SUSE Linux操作系统提供了多种命令来管理防火墙。以下是一些常用的SUSE Linux防火墙命令:
1. `iptables`命令:`iptables`是一个非常常用的Linux防火墙管理工具。它可以用于设置、修改和删除防火墙规则。例如,要新增一条防火墙规则,可以使用以下命令:
“`
iptables -A INPUT -p tcp –dport 22 -j ACCEPT
“`
这个命令将允许通过SSH协议访问TCP端口22。2. `firewalld`命令:SUSE Linux中还可以使用`firewalld`命令来管理防火墙。`firewalld`是一个动态防火墙管理器,可以根据不同的网络环境动态调整防火墙规则。以下是一些常用的`firewalld`命令:
– `firewall-cmd –list-all`:显示当前的防火墙规则和配置信息。
– `firewall-cmd –zone=public –add-port=80/tcp –permanent`:将端口80添加到public区域的规则中,并将该规则永久保存。这个命令将允许通过HTTP协议访问TCP端口80。3. `SuSEfirewall2`命令:`SuSEfirewall2`是SUSE Linux中的另一个防火墙管理工具。它基于`iptables`,并提供了一套更高级的命令和配置文件。以下是一些常用的`SuSEfirewall2`命令:
– `SuSEfirewall2 status`:显示当前防火墙的状态。
– `SuSEfirewall2 open PORT/tcp`:打开指定的TCP端口。4. `ufw`命令:`ufw`是Uncomplicated Firewall的缩写,是一个用于简化防火墙配置的前端工具。虽然`ufw`不是SUSE Linux的默认防火墙管理工具,但它可以通过安装来使用。以下是一些常用的`ufw`命令:
– `ufw enable`:启用防火墙。
– `ufw allow 22/tcp`:允许通过SSH协议访问TCP端口22。5. `yast`命令:`yast`是SUSE Linux的系统管理工具,可以用于配置和管理多个方面的系统功能,包括防火墙。通过`yast`命令,可以以图形化界面的方式进行防火墙规则的配置和管理。
以上是一些常用的SUSE Linux防火墙管理命令。根据具体的需求和环境,选择合适的命令进行防火墙的配置和管理。
2年前 -
SUSE Linux是一种常用的Linux操作系统,它使用了一套名为YaST的图形界面工具来管理系统配置。在SUSE Linux中,可以使用命令行来配置和管理防火墙。下面将介绍一些常用的SUSE Linux防火墙命令。
1. 启动和停止防火墙
启动防火墙:
“`
sudo systemctl start firewalld
“`
停止防火墙:
“`
sudo systemctl stop firewalld
“`
重启防火墙:
“`
sudo systemctl restart firewalld
“`2. 查看防火墙状态
查看防火墙状态:
“`
sudo systemctl status firewalld
“`
显示当前防火墙规则:
“`
sudo firewall-cmd –list-all
“`3. 添加和删除防火墙规则
添加防火墙规则:
“`
sudo firewall-cmd –add-service=服务名 –permanent
“`
例如,如果要开放HTTP服务(端口号80),可以使用以下命令:
“`
sudo firewall-cmd –add-service=http –permanent
“`
如果要开放自定义端口(例如8080),可以使用以下命令:
“`
sudo firewall-cmd –add-port=8080/tcp –permanent
“`
删除防火墙规则:
“`
sudo firewall-cmd –remove-service=服务名 –permanent
“`
或者:
“`
sudo firewall-cmd –remove-port=端口号/tcp –permanent
“`
添加或删除规则后,需要重新加载防火墙配置文件:
“`
sudo firewall-cmd –reload
“`4. 配置防火墙区域
默认情况下,SUSE Linux防火墙分为“public”、“external”、“dmz”、“work”和“home”等几个区域。可以使用以下命令设置特定区域的防火墙规则:
“`
sudo firewall-cmd –zone=区域 –add-service=服务名 –permanent
“`
例如,将HTTP服务添加到“work”区域的规则中:
“`
sudo firewall-cmd –zone=work –add-service=http –permanent
“`5. 保存防火墙配置
在添加或删除规则后,需要保存防火墙配置才能永久生效:
“`
sudo firewall-cmd –runtime-to-permanent
“`使用这些SUSE Linux防火墙命令,您可以轻松配置和管理防火墙规则,保护服务器和网络安全。请注意在进行任何更改之前,最好备份防火墙配置文件以防止操作错误导致网络中断。
2年前